2. Safety Instructions
Failure to follow these safety instructions can result in serious injury or damage to the inverter and connected devices. Always exercise caution when working with electricity.
- Ventilation: Ensure the inverter is installed in a well-ventilated area. Do not block the ventilation openings.
- Moisture: Do not expose the inverter to water, rain, snow, or spray.
- Heat: Avoid placing the inverter near heat sources or in direct sunlight.
- Flammable Materials: Do not operate the inverter near flammable materials, gases, or vapors.
- Battery Connection: Connect the inverter only to a 12V DC battery. Ensure correct polarity (+ to + and - to -). Incorrect connection will damage the inverter.
- Load Capacity: Do not exceed the inverter's rated power output (3000W continuous, 6000W peak). Overloading can cause damage and fire hazards.
- Grounding: Ensure the inverter is properly grounded according to local electrical codes.
- Maintenance: Do not attempt to open or service the inverter yourself. Refer all servicing to qualified personnel.
- Children: Keep the inverter out of reach of children.

4. Setup and Installation
Follow these steps to properly set up your power inverter:
- Choose a Location: Select a dry, cool, and well-ventilated area for the inverter. Ensure it is away from direct sunlight, heat, and moisture.
- Prepare the Battery: Ensure your 12V DC battery is fully charged and in good condition.
- Connect Cables:
- Connect the red positive (+) cable to the positive (+) terminal of the inverter.
- Connect the other end of the red cable to the positive (+) terminal of the 12V battery.
- Connect the black negative (-) cable to the negative (-) terminal of the inverter.
- Connect the other end of the black cable to the negative (-) terminal of the 12V battery.
Important: Ensure all connections are tight and secure to prevent loose connections, which can cause overheating and damage.
- Grounding: Connect the inverter's grounding terminal to a proper earth ground.
- Initial Check: Before connecting any appliances, ensure the inverter's power switch is in the "OFF" position.

5. Operating Instructions
5.1. Front and Rear Panel Overview
Image 5.1: Detailed view of the inverter's front and rear panels, highlighting the positive/negative ports, dual cooling fans, battery voltage display, voltage output display, USB port, On/Off switch, AC sockets, and LED indicators.
- Positive Port: Red terminal for positive battery connection.
- Negative Port: Black terminal for negative battery connection.
- Dual Cooling Fans: Automatically activate based on temperature and load.
- Battery Voltage Display: Shows the current DC input voltage from the battery.
- Voltage Output Display: Shows the AC output voltage.
- USB Port: For charging USB-powered devices.
- On/Off Switch: Main power switch for the inverter.
- AC Sockets: Two 230V AC outlets for connecting appliances.
- LED Indicator: Indicates power status and fault conditions.
5.2. Powering On and Connecting Appliances
- Ensure all battery connections are secure.
- Flip the On/Off switch on the inverter to the "ON" position. The LED indicator should light up, and the voltage displays will show readings.
- Plug your 230V AC appliances into the inverter's AC sockets.
- For USB charging, connect your device to the USB port.
- To power off, first turn off all connected appliances, then flip the inverter's On/Off switch to the "OFF" position.
5.3. Using the Wireless Remote Control
The wireless remote control allows you to turn the inverter on and off from a distance.
- Press button 'A' to turn the inverter ON.
- Press button 'B' to turn the inverter OFF.
- The remote control only functions when the inverter's main switch is in the 'OFF' position.
6. Key Features
- Pure Sine Wave Output: This inverter produces a pure sine wave output, which is identical to the AC power supplied by utility companies. This makes it suitable for sensitive electronics, motors, and inductive loads that may not operate correctly or efficiently with modified sine wave inverters.
- High-Quality Components: Equipped with high-quality MOSFET/IGBT transistors and active cooling control, ensuring stable performance and low heat generation.
- Intelligent Cooling System: Features dual cooling fans that operate based on temperature and load, reducing noise and ensuring efficient heat dissipation.

7. Protection Functions
The inverter is equipped with multiple modern safety features to protect itself and your connected devices:
- Low Voltage Protection: Automatically shuts down if the input DC voltage drops too low, preventing battery over-discharge.
- High Temperature Protection: Activates if the internal temperature exceeds safe limits (e.g., 75°C), preventing overheating.
- High Voltage Protection: Protects against excessive input DC voltage.
- Short Circuit Protection: Safeguards against short circuits in the output.
- Reverse-Connection Protection: Protects against incorrect battery polarity connection (typically via a blown fuse).
- Overload Protection: Shuts down if the connected load exceeds the inverter's capacity.
- Soft Start: Ensures a gradual power-up to protect sensitive equipment.
- Automatic Voltage Regulation (AVR): Maintains stable output voltage.
- Intelligent Power Management (IPM): Optimizes power delivery.

8. Maintenance
To ensure the longevity and optimal performance of your inverter, follow these maintenance guidelines:
- Cleaning: Keep the inverter clean and free from dust and debris. Use a dry, soft cloth for cleaning. Do not use liquid cleaners.
- Ventilation: Regularly check that the cooling vents are not obstructed.
- Connections: Periodically inspect battery and appliance connections to ensure they remain tight and free from corrosion.
- Storage: If storing the inverter for an extended period, disconnect it from the battery and store it in a cool, dry place.
- Battery Health: Ensure your 12V battery is well-maintained and charged to prolong its life and the inverter's efficiency.
9.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your inverter, refer to the following common problems and solutions:
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Inverter does not turn on. | Loose battery connection, low battery voltage, blown fuse, inverter switch off. | Check battery cables for secure connection. Charge battery. Replace fuses (refer to spare fuses provided). Ensure inverter switch is ON. |
| No AC output. | Overload, high temperature, low battery voltage, fault condition. | Reduce connected load. Allow inverter to cool down. Charge battery. Check LED indicators for fault codes. |
| Inverter shuts down unexpectedly. | Overload, high temperature, low battery voltage. | This is a protection feature. Reduce load, ensure proper ventilation, or charge battery. |
| Remote control not working. | Inverter's main switch is ON, remote battery dead. | Ensure the inverter's main switch is in the 'OFF' position for remote operation. Replace remote battery if necessary. |
If the problem persists after following these steps, please contact customer support.
10. Specifications
| Feature | Specification |
|---|---|
| Model Number | 3000W12V |
| Rated Power | 3000 W |
| Peak Power (Short-term) | 6000 W |
| DC Input Voltage | 12 V DC |
| AC Output Voltage | 190-240 V AC (for 220V/230V/240V) |
| Frequency | 50 Hz |
| Efficiency | 90% |
| No-Load Current | ≤ 1 A |
| Output Waveform | Pure Sine Wave |
| Temperature Protection | 75 °C |
| Net Weight | 5.5 kg |
| Dimensions (L x W x H) | 400 x 180 x 140 mm (approx.) |
| Total Power Outlets | 2 |
